Regular medical checkups according to the reference chart for growth and development is necessary to determine if a child's growth and development are on track.
Explanation:
Regular checkup necessary for tracking those details. Doctor checks everything in detail like growth of body and hairs. They also ask something about diet, physical activities, behavior etc.
This shows the development is on track or not. If it is not up to the mark the doctor suggest several nutrition’s plan and physical activities for the child. And this checkup should be done on regular basis to track the development.
